I finally was able to watch The Irishman, although I was a little pissed that my friend had his tv set to motion smoothing, it made the entire movie feel less cinematic.

 

It was a fine movie, but I think they messed up with how they handled time moving forwards and backwards, and they messed up with how they are trying to set up the tension and the conflict that Frank Sheerhan finds himself in the middle of.

 

I really like the way Joe Pesci handled his part, and I think they should've spent more on his character, I would've loved to know more about his backstory.

 

And technically, I don't they did a good job telling the early years of Frank Sheerhan, I was expecting more from his war years and him transitioning into the Teamsters.

 

Al Pacino kills it. Vintage Pacino.

Watched Shot Caller on Netflix

 

 

Had never heard of it, but was interested to see how Jamie Lannister was outside of GoT and I'll watch anything with Jon Bernthal in it.

 

It was pretty good. Film jumps between two timelines like it's doing hopscotch, but I think it's pretty effective in contrasting who he is now and how he got there. Little quick and lacking more detail on some of the changes he goes through, especially the ones relating to some pretty major philosophical changes, but what's there is interesting, well paced, well acted, and intriguing. I liked it. Not perfect, but a really good watch for anybody that enjoyed something like Oz.
